1. Optimize the structure of your Shopify site
Simplify the organization of content to make it easier to navigate your website. The fewer clicks the user must make to reach the purchase of your product, the better. In a simple structure, your potential buyers need only two steps to find what they are looking for from the home page. Also, you should simplify crawling by search engines. Always think in terms of your users. Apart from these pages, add one that talks about your business and another with the contact information. Similarly, it is recommended to include a search field or box.
2. Improve the user experience
The user experience is that moment in which the user interacts with a product. And whose result can make you win, loyalty or lose a customer. And, in addition, it helps your site’s ranking in search results or SEO positioning. Therefore, you must control the following parameters:
- Your site must have the required speed that allows accessibility and ease of navigation in your store.
- It occupies templates with compatible themes for the mobile phone interface. Optimize images, remove unnecessary plugins and applications that are not in use, and use light navigation controls.
- It uses a design adaptable to each type of screen, called responsive. This will allow your users to more quickly identify the interface from any device. And that your browsing time is better used.
3. Research the right target keywords to improve SEO rankings
The general term used for this research is keyword research and to carry it out there are different processes and applications that alleviate the work, since it is something exhaustive. First, make a list of those words, terms or concepts related to your customers. Those with whom they identify your product. Then, analyze this list with keyword research tools to obtain the real data of search volumes. In this case, there are paid tools and other free ones, such as SEMRush

Prepare in an Excel document the list with their respective volumes and select those that you consider most important for your site, avoiding cannibalization or repetition of terms that compete on your own website. Select and organize your listing in informative or general keywords. Finally, prepare a separate list with the long tail keywords that help you to specialize and differentiate from the more generic ones.
4. Perfect your Shopify product pages
Start with those pages that are most profitable for your business. If you still have no experience in the market and you are just starting out, then focus on the home page. Then review those that have already received the most visits and interactions. Along with those that have the most requested products and keywords by your users. Another action to improve Shopify SEO is category title tag optimization. That is, how you are going to name the pages of your site. Use your keywords consistently. For instance: Keyword 1 – Buy Keyword 2 – Store Name Do not forget to optimize the titles, meta description, categories and the alternative text of the images.
5. Create links to your site
Obtain external links a strategy that generates trust and credibility. To obtain them there are various sources such as:
- Links from suppliers or manufacturers that link to your store.
- Influencers or representatives of your field with whom to interact and generate content.
- Detect broken links to similar services or products that harm SEO. Contact your landlord for repair and get a feedback link.
6. Work with content marketing
Generate quality content that more than sell, explain the benefits, sales and uses of your products. Let the user experience count when using your product, as well as the opinions of those who have already used it.
